[QUOTE="gagvanman, post: 625460, member: 17411"] Been having a low oil pressure issue when the engine is warm, and oil leaks. Took the engine out yesterday using the new lift I modified. Stripped the engine down today and found that the oil cooler is loose. That would explain the oil leak. I am guessing that it could also be causing the low oil pressure when warm as the oil cooler is bypassed until the engine reaches a certain temperature. Anyone confirm that for me. However, I am still going to split the engine as it looks like there are some small metal particles in the oil. [/QUOTE]
